Antonio Quartulli is a networking-focused software engineer and entrepreneur with over 13 years of hands-on experience and 15+ years in the network engineering space, currently CEO and co-founder of Mandelbit and a Principal Engineer at OpenVPN. He combines deep kernel-level expertise (Linux networking, DCO/ovpn kernel module, mac/cfg80211) with protocol design and distributed systems work such as DHTs, mesh networks and OpenWrt-based firmware. A prolific open-source contributor, he has improved stability and security in projects like OpenVPN and contributed backend DHT and configuration work to the notable LBRY SDK, plus critical fixes to widely used tools like axel. He advises and invests through multiple holding and advisory roles, translating low-level technical know-how into product-focused consulting and long-term support for open-source drivers. Based in Trentino, Italy, he pairs rigorous engineering (race-condition fixes, memory-leak remediation, build-pipeline hardening) with an unusual side interest in wine importing and WSET certification, reflecting a pragmatic, detail-oriented but worldly approach.

Contributions summary:Antonio primarily contributed to the OpenVPN project's core functionality and security aspects. Their work included improvements to the authentication mechanism, specifically with auth-user-pass and the handling of inline credentials. Furthermore, they enhanced the code by addressing memory leaks, refactoring to enhance code readability and maintainability. The user also worked on improving the security by removing code and options that are deprecated and less secure, and the handling of SSL connections.

Contributions summary:Antonio primarily contributed to the OpenVPN 3 codebase by implementing features related to the underlying protocol. They fixed bugs related to remote list resolution and added logging support for macOS. They also developed features necessary for a robust build pipeline by creating configuration files and build scripts for Travis CI and Coverity SCAN, including incorporating support for multiple SSL libraries. Furthermore, the user improved test unit coverage and performed code refactoring tasks for enhanced code stability and maintainability.
